SYMPOSIUM: Climate Policy (Part II) was held on Tuesday, May 8, 2007 at DEQ.
*Click below to view the archived webcast.*
Presentations included:
Welcome and introduction – Rick Sprott, Utah Division of Air Quality
Carbon Capture and Sequestration - Bill Townsend, Blue Source - Bio
; Ray Levey, EGI - Bio ![]()
Electricity Technology in a Carbon-Constrained Future – Electric Power Research Institute (EPRI), Bryan Hannegan - Bio ![]()
Break
Renewable Portfolio Standards – Ryan Wiser, Lawrence Berkeley National Laboratory - Bio ![]()
Panel Discussion, Renewables Portfolio Standards
SYMPOSIUM: Climate Policy (Part I) was held on Tuesday, April 24, 2007 at DEQ.
*Click below to view the archived webcast.*
Presentations included:
Greenhouse Gas Emissions Goal-Setting – Kurt Maurer, Arizona Department of Environmental Quality - Bio ![]()
Cap and Trade Programs – Kyle Davis, Manager of Environmental Policy and Strategy, PacifiCorp - Bio ![]()
Carbon Tax – Dr. Gary Bryner, Professor of Political Science, BYU - Bio ![]()
Greenhouse Gas Emissions Registries – Joel Levin, Vice President of Business Development, California Climate Action Registry (CCAR) - Bio
